ORA-01104: number of control files (string) does not equal string

文档解释

ORA-01104: number of control files (string) does not equal string

Cause: The number of control files used by this instance disagrees with the number of control files in an existing instance.

Action: Check to make sure that all control files are listed.

ORA-01104: number of control files (string) does not equal string 意味着控制文件的数量不等于指定的数量。

官方解释

当数据库参数CONTROL_FILES的值指定的控制文件数量不等于实际控制文件的数量时,该错误信息将显示。

常见案例

比如,当在控制文件中指定三个控制文件但只有两个控制文件时,将会引发这个错误。

正常处理方法及步骤

1.确保控制文件的位置以及名称已经正确配置。

2.如果有控制文件被删除,那么可以使用DBMS_BACKUP_RESTORE包中的add_file函数来增加一个新的控制文件。

3.如果想更改实际控制文件数量,使用CONFIGURE CONTROLFILE文件的ALTER DATABASE块。

4.最后,使用新的参数重启数据库。

你可能感兴趣的